People had urged Thomas to go west even as Thomas Shoupe was set on going to North Carolina in 1845. Those that he had talked with during his journey from New York down along the Eastern edge of the Appalachian Mountains said that there was good land for a young man to prove up in the west. George and Archibald Mull had been talking of heading west to open a store in the Oregon Territories. hey had been in contact with a shipping company that sailed out of Charleston, South Carolina. They shipped to Central America and carted items to the Pacific side to be taken on to California and Oregon. George and Arch decided to travel with Thomas on a cross country covered wagon trek and had made in to within a day or so of Independence, Missouri.
